Hi Michael,

Thanks for clarifying. I suggest moving that sentence out of the 
Security & Privacy section and into the Assignment section. I might 
rephrase it as so:

"The KNX Association may assign special meaning in its specifications to 
certain substrings within the Namespace Specific String (NSS), e.g., an 
NSS beginning with 'dpt' might refer to a datapoint type."

This would appear be more accurate and it would also alleviate concerns 
about the seemingly nonexistent security implications of such substrings.

>>    * Namespace Identifier: knx (example „urn:knx:dpa“)
>>    * Version: 1
>>    * Date: 2023-09-07
>>    * Registrant: KNX Association cvba, De Kleetlaan 5, B-1831
>>      Brussels-Diegem, Belgium
>>        o Joost Demarest joost.demarest@knx.org
>>          <mailto:joost.demarest@knx.org>
>>    * Purpose: KNX IoT Point API, as specified on https://schema.knx.org
>>      <https://schema.knx.org> (specifically
>>      https://knxcloud.org/index.php/s/KNjAyyO0ojm5LSc/download
>>      <https://knxcloud.org/index.php/s/KNjAyyO0ojm5LSc/download>) and
>>      future EN50090-4-4, see note above on pending editorial changes.
>>    * Syntax: urn:knx:<NSS> where the syntax of "<NSS>" is specified in
>>      Section 2.2 of the URN Syntax requirements [RFC8141].
>>    * Assignment: Assignment done by KNX Association through KNX
>>      Specifications.
>>    * Security and Privacy:
>>        o There are no additional security considerations other than those
>>          normally associated with the use and resolution of URNs in
>>          general, which are described in [RFC1737
>>          <https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c1737>] and [RFC8141
>>          <https://www.rfc-editor.org/rfc/rfc8141>].
>>        o This document registers a namespace for URNs.  KNX Association
>>          may assign special meaning to certain characters of the
>>          Namespace Specific String (NSS) in its specifications.
>>    * Interoperability: No known issues related to interoperability.
>>    * Resolution: Not applicable; the "knx" namespace is not listed with a
>>      Resolution Discovery System.
>>    * Documentation: KNX IoT Point API, as specified on
>>      https://schema.knx.org <https://schema.knx.org> (specifically
>>      https://knxcloud.org/index.php/s/KNjAyyO0ojm5LSc/download
>>      <https://knxcloud.org/index.php/s/KNjAyyO0ojm5LSc/download>) and
>>      future EN50090-4-4, see note above on pending editorial changes.
>>    * Additional Information: Not applicable
>>    * Revision Information: Not applicable
